4、Structural advantages of Regenerative burner chamber heating furnace

The Regenerative burner chamber heating furnace structure is introduced as follows:

  1. combustor
  2. The device that mixes natural gas with combustion-supporting air and ejects it is the core component of the heating furnace.

  3. convection chamber
  4. The material is heated by convection heat transfer of high temperature flue gas discharged from the radiation chamber. Flue gas washes the tube wall of the furnace tube at a high speed to carry out effective convection heat transfer, and its heat load accounts for about 20%-30% of the whole furnace. The convection chamber is generally arranged above the radiation chamber, and some are placed on the ground alone. In order to improve the heat transfer effect, nail head tubes or finned tubes are often used in furnace tubes.

  5. ventilation system
  6. Ensure the gas flow in the furnace and maintain the stability of the atmosphere and temperature in the furnace.

  7. Radiation chamber
  8. The heat load of the main place for Regenerative burner chamber heating furnace heat exchange accounts for about 70%-80% of the whole furnace. The furnace tube in the radiation room conducts heat through flame or high-temperature flue gas, which is mainly radiant heat, so it is called radiation tube.

  9. furnace chamber
  10. A space for holding metallic materials for heating.

Regenerative burner chamber heating furnaceIt has a wide range of uses, including Metal forging heating, Improve production efficiency, Metal tempering, Metal melting and casting and Improve production efficiency,in the course of work,Heat of combustion based on fuel. Natural gas is sprayed from the burner, mixed with combustion-supporting air and burned to produce high-temperature flame and smoke. These high-temperature flames and smoke transfer heat to the metal materials in the furnace by radiation and convection, so that they gradually heat up to the temperature required for forging.。
